117.info
人生若只如初见

数据库关系模型的概念是什么

数据库关系模型是一种用于描述和组织数据库中数据的概念模型。它基于数学关系理论,主要用于定义数据之间的逻辑关系,以及数据的组织和操作方式。数据库关系模型的核心概念是关系(Relation),它是由一张或多张具有相同结构的表格组成的,每张表格由若干行和列组成。关系模型通过定义表格的结构和表格之间的关联关系,来描述和组织数据。

数据库关系模型的主要特点包括:

  1. 数据以表格的形式进行组织和存储,每个表格包含多个行和列。

  2. 表格中的每个列都有一个定义好的数据类型,用于限制该列中存储的数据类型。

  3. 关系模型通过定义主键(Primary Key)和外键(Foreign Key)来建立表格之间的关联关系。

  4. 关系模型支持对数据的增删改查操作,以及对数据的完整性和一致性进行约束和检查。

  5. 关系模型还提供了一种查询语言(如SQL)来方便地对数据库中的数据进行查询和操作。

关系模型是目前最常用的数据库模型之一,被广泛应用于各种类型的数据库系统,包括关系型数据库(如MySQL、Oracle等)和面向对象数据库等。它提供了一种灵活、可扩展和易于理解的数据组织方式,使得用户可以方便地对数据库中的数据进行管理和操作。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fedffAzsLBARVA1A.html

推荐文章

  • 数据库top的用法是什么

    top 是一个实时显示系统中各个进程的资源占用状况的工具,在Linux和Unix系统中广泛使用 查看系统进程:
    在终端中输入 top 并按回车键,你将看到一个实时更新...

  • 好用的数据库管理软件有哪些

    以下是一些常用的数据库管理软件: MySQL Workbench:MySQL官方推出的数据库管理工具,提供了图形化界面和丰富的功能,支持MySQL数据库的管理、开发和设计。 Nav...

  • 备份数据库的sql语句怎么写

    备份数据库的SQL语句可以根据不同的数据库系统有所不同。以下是一些常见数据库系统的备份语句示例:
    MySQL数据库:
    mysqldump -u username -p passwor...

  • 数据库范式是什么

    数据库范式是一种规范化数据库设计的方法,旨在减少数据库中数据的冗余和重复。范式化设计可以提高数据库的性能、减少数据的存储空间,并确保数据的一致性和完整...

  • 如何解除win10用户账户控制

    要解除Windows 10用户账户控制,您可以按照以下步骤操作: 打开控制面板:右键点击开始菜单,选择“控制面板”。 在控制面板中,选择“用户账户”。 在用户账户窗...

  • win10计划任务不执行如何解决

    如果Windows 10计划任务不执行,可以尝试以下方法解决: 检查计划任务设置:打开“任务计划程序库”,找到相应的计划任务,检查其设置是否正确,包括触发器、操作...

  • java怎么遍历实体类获取属性值

    在Java中,可以使用反射来遍历实体类并获取属性值。下面是一个示例代码:
    import java.lang.reflect.Field;
    import java.lang.reflect.InvocationTarg...

  • java集合为什么要遍历

    Java集合需要遍历是因为遍历能够访问集合中的每个元素,并对元素进行相应的操作。具体原因如下: 获取集合中的每个元素:通过遍历集合,可以依次访问集合中的每个...